About Ebook Reader
Ebook Reader is free, and optimized for the iPad, iPhone and iPod touch. It supports multitasking on both iPhone/iPad, and high resolution Retina Display graphics.
. Turn pages with a tap or swipe
. Zoom with a pinch
. Never lose your place in the book
. Landscape or portrait orientation is lockable . Read sample chapters before you buy
. Easy navigation inside the book
. Search for text inside books . Night-reading mode is easy on the eyes . Adjust font size with a tap.
. Login with your existing eBooks.com account
. Sync your eBooks.com online bookshelf with all your iOS devices
. Online synchronization of your bookmarks, highlights, notes and reading place with all your iOS devices
. Importing of 3rd party books
. Group your books in collections
. Free classics at your fingertips immediately
. Online backup - your online ebook library is always accessible, so anytime you get a new phone, your books are ready to download from your eBooks.com bookshelf.
